English: Irokawa Kunio (色川 圀士, June 14, 1845 – February 14, 1919) was a Japanese government official and educator during the Meiji era.
日本語: 色川 圀士(いろかわ くにお、弘化2年5月10日(1845年6月14日) – 大正8年(1919年)2月14日)は明治時代の日本の官僚、教育者。
